Non-prescription medications are pharmaceuticals that can be bought without a prescription from a doctor. These medications are normally considered safe and efficient for public use when customers follow the directions on the product packaging and use them for the suggested functions.

Dangers and Considerations
Even though OTC medications offer benefit, they also carry risks if misused. Here are some essential considerations:
Potential Risks of OTC Medication Use
Drug Interactions: Some OTC medications can connect with prescribed drugs, potentially reducing their effectiveness or increasing the risk of negative effects.

Overdosing: Consumers might mistakenly take more than the suggested dose, causing severe health risks, especially with [Pain Relief Medications](https://doc.adminforge.de/s/NVxk6x-c4t) relievers and cold medications.

Misdiagnosis: Relying entirely on OTC medications may result in delayed or missed medical diagnosis of more severe health issues.

Allergic Reactions: Some individuals may experience allergic responses to particular elements of OTC medications.
